Famous Irish Theosophists Annie Besant, second International President of the Theosophical Society (1907-1933) William Quan Judge was a founding member of the T.S. and headed the first Society in America W.B.Yeats, the celebrated poet and Senator. George William Russell (AE) poet and artist. Others involved with the Irish Literary Renaissance of the late 19th and early 20th centuries were also members or were influenced by Theosophy.
